General Steps for Applying for Construction Loans

Here's a straightforward outline of the key steps to follow when applying for a construction loan:

  • Assess Your Project and Financial Readiness: Begin by evaluating your construction plans, budget, and personal finances. This helps determine the loan amount you'll need. For more on our loan options, visit our Mortgage Loans page to explore available types.
  • Check Eligibility and Gather Documentation: Review the basic requirements, such as credit score, income verification, and property details. You'll typically need to provide items like proof of income, construction plans, and builder contracts. Our About page offers insights into our team's expertise to assist with this.
  • Apply for Pre-Approval: Submit a pre-approval application to get a sense of your borrowing capacity. This step can be initiated through our secure portal. Learn more about pre-approval on our Pre-Approval page.
  • Submit Full Application and Undergo Review: Once pre-approved, provide all necessary documents for a full review. Factors like loan-to-value ratio and your financial status will be evaluated.
  • Close the Loan and Draw Funds: Upon approval, finalize the loan agreement and draw funds as needed during construction phases. For any questions, reach out via our Contact Us page.

Key Requirements and Factors for Funding Approval

To increase your chances of approval, consider these essential factors: a strong credit score (typically 620 or higher), a sufficient down payment (often 20-30% for construction loans), stable income, and detailed project plans. Other elements include the property's location in 93703, which may affect interest rates and terms, and your debt-to-income ratio. Calculating Loan Payments for Construction

When estimating payments for construction loans in the 93703 area, several key factors come into play. Interest rates are a primary influence, as they determine the cost of borrowing; higher rates can significantly increase your monthly payments, while lower rates may make financing more manageable. Loan terms, such as the duration of the loan (e.g., 5 to 30 years), also affect payments by spreading out the cost over time, potentially lowering monthly amounts but increasing total interest paid.

Other elements like the loan amount, down payment, and property type can further impact your estimates. Considerations for Construction in 93703, California

When planning construction projects in the 93703 zip code of Fresno, California, several regional factors can influence your financing options. For instance, local construction costs for a typical home may vary based on market conditions, ranging from approximately $324,286 to $582,584 for a 2,000 sq ft property. Factors such as Fresno County regulations, availability of local lenders, and specific loan programs like FHA or USDA options could affect the terms and eligibility for your construction loan.
